Reliance JioPhone second phase of booking begins, but there’s a catch!

Reliance has started the second phase of booking for JioPhone in India. Reliance Retail will now start the process of booking the 4G-enabled feature phone, however, this time the booking process will be not open for all.

The company has confirmed that it will be sending out to only those who have earlier shown interest in buying the phone. About 10 million people had shown interest in JioPhone in July and the message will be sent to all of them. “A link will be sent to people who are again showing interest to make payment of Rs 500 on the authorised channel. Once they make payment, they will be informed about the date when JioPhone will be delivered to them,” a Reliance Jio channel partner told PTI.

This time Reliance JioPhone will face a tough competition with other manufacturers. Bharti Airtel has already launched its new lineup of budget-friendly smartphones with Karbonn A40 Indian, Karbonn A1 Indian, Karbonn A41 Power and Celkon Smart which is available at an effective price of below Rs 1,500.

Vodafone recently partnered with Micromax to launch a new affordable 4G-enabled smartphone known as Bharat 2 Ultra. The smartphone with Vodafone SuperNet 4G connection will be available at an effective price of Rs 999. Similarly, Idea Cellular is also planning to launch a series of affordable smartphones around Rs 1,500 or less.

On July 21, Reliance unveiled the JioPhone feature phone for the Indian consumers. The 4G-enabled feature phone is said to cost you Rs Zero. However, one has to pay Rs 1,500 as a security deposit, which will be 100 percent refundable after three years. The company is providing free voice calls, unlimited data and Jio apps for Rs 153 per month with Jio Dhan Dhana Dhan plans to JioPhone customers. Further, there two sachets, one with Rs 24 for two days and Rs 54 plan for a week. Users will enjoy the same benefits as the monthly recharge of Rs 153.
